FACTON, the leader in Enterprise Product Costing (EPC), today announced that president Ruediger Stern will be a featured speaker at an upcoming event produced by the Original Equipment Suppliers Association (OESA) on July 27, 2017. The event, titled “Sales & Purchasing: Partners in New Business Pursuit Conference” will be at the Edward Hotel & Conference Center in Dearborn, Michigan, and begins at 8:00am ET.  Mr. Stern will share insights on how enterprise product costing software can accelerate quote response times and improve customer relationships. His presentation will include examples from real-world case studies focused on how automotive suppliers and OEMs have improved costing processes. The FACTON Enterprise Product Costing (EPC) Suite consists of specific solutions that address the product costing requirements of company departments and divisions – from top management, controlling and production to development, purchasing and sales. Trimble announced today that it has added its first distribution partner in Latin America to its Vantage™ network—a global network of independent distribution partners that provide growers, advisors, retailers, co-ops and local OEM dealers with precision agriculture expertise for the entire farm. Trimble and Geo Agri have worked together for more than 20 years and have developed a strong relationship that promotes and delivers Trimble precision agriculture solutions to farmers in Brazil. Both companies recognize the growth potential of farming, and as a result, have jointly developed a growth plan for a new Vantage distribution network in the region. Committing to this new plan, Geo Agri will be the first Vantage distribution partner in Latin America—Vantage Centro-Sul. Vantage Centro-Sul will be headquartered in the current Geo Agri office in Ribeirão Preto, Sao Paulo, Brazil and will offer Trimble total farm solutions throughout the states of Sao Paulo, Minas Gerais and Goiás.  PDF Siemens PLM Software, in conjunction with Siemens AG, is taking a fresh approach to solving challenges in today’s energy industry. To drive further progress, the company recently held an Energy Executive Council event in Houston, Texas, with attendance from key influencers throughout the industry, including independent oil companies (IOCs); oilfield services firms; oilfield equipment manufacturers; and engineering, procurement, and construction (EPC) firms. The energy industry has traditionally adopted highly customized engineering processes for developing projects, and has struggled to reuse design information from project to project as well as to integrate that information throughout the lifecycles of projects. Lack of information integration and reuse has resulted in higher costs due to errors and process friction, ultimately leading to longer, more expensive project cycles. Arrow Electronics, Inc. has signed a global distribution agreement with Bosch Sensortec to supply Bosch Sensortec products. Bosch is a leading supplier of MEMS (microelectromechanical systems) sensors worldwide. It has built on an initial base in automotive applications to expand its offering to consumer electronics markets and now provides a diverse portfolio of MEMS devices for the internet of things (IoT). Arrow offers an extensive range of IoT solutions, from component level through to complete secure, end-to-end deployable services. Since 1995, Bosch has designed and manufactured over eight billion MEMS sensors and holds more than 1,000 patents on MEMS technology. Its in-house expertise is fuelling a roadmap of products, together with supporting software and reference designs, that enable mobile and IoT devices to feel and sense the world around them. X-Rite Incorporated and its subsidiary Pantone LLC today announced that Allegorithmic's material authoring tool, Substance Designer, will natively support the Appearance Exchange Format (AxF™) in September. Developed by X-Rite, AxF is a vendor-neutral format that enables the communication of all aspects of a physical material's appearance – color, texture, gloss, refraction, translucency, special effects (sparkles) and reflection properties – in a single, editable file to improve design virtualization. AxF allows Substance Designer users to create physically correct, virtual materials that reduce design time and offer the most compelling, photorealistic 3D images possible. X-Rite and Allegorithmic will showcase the AxF integration in Substance Designer at SIGGRAPH 2017, July 30 – August 3 in Los Angeles. AxF is the foundational component of the X-Rite Total Appearance Capture (TAC™) ecosystem, a solution that brings a new level of accuracy and efficiency to the capture, communication and presentation of physical materials in the virtual world.
